The Steam Community Beta Released
The Steam website yesterday launched the (brand new) Steam Community Beta. If you have any friends that are playing some sort of PC Game or just want find some new ones with the same similar interests, the Steam Community could be the right place to do that. With some new features and options designed to make it easier to play games with friends, Steam Community is free and open to all users. Here is a short list of the new options available: Easily see your friends online Schedule group events Create a SteamID user profile Create and join groups Access Steam from within any game Track gameplay stats New chat rooms and game lobbies Voice chat in-game or out To find out more informations about how to take part in the beta you can visit The Valve Developer Community website.
